JKP to lock-horns with BSF Jammu in summit clash

Excelsior Sports Correspondent

JAMMU, Nov 2: Defeating their rivals convincingly in the semifinals, BSF Jammu and JKP have sealed berth in the finals of Shaheed Baba Banda Singh Bahadur Hockey Tournament today and will take on each other in the summit clash at KK Hakhu Astroturf Hockey Stadium, here tomorrow.
Earlier, in the first semifinal, BSF Jammu got better of Khalsa Club Gole Gujral by one goal to nil (1-0). Anish Kumar was the goal scorer, who netted it in 18th minute of the match. Dr SK Bali, Head of the Department, Nephrology, Government Medical College Jammu was the chief guest on the occasion, while Dr SS Sodhi was the guest of honour.
In another semifinal match played today, JKP blanked Hirannagar  Hockey Club by seven goals to nil (7-0). Surinder Singh and Skinder Pal Singh pelted 2 goals each, while Sunil, Manjeet Singh and Sohail Azim scored one goal each. MLC Charanjeet Singh Khalsa was the chief guest on the occasion, while Jaswant Singh, retired Assistant Commissioner was the guest of honour.
The matches were officiated by Jagjeet Singh, Karanjeet Singh and Joginder Singh, while the tournament is being organized by Kashmir Sikh Sangat (KSS), under the aegis of Hockey J&K.
The tournament is being held under the supervision of Dr Dhanwant Singh, Chairman KSS, Satinder Singh Bali, Coordinator of the event, TP Singh, Organising Secretary and Karamjeet Singh, General Secretary KSS.
